小程序开发框架选择:如何避免常见陷阱
小程序开发框架选择:如何避免常见陷阱
一、框架选型的误区
在选择小程序开发框架时,许多开发者容易陷入以下误区:
1. 追求大而全:认为框架功能越多,开发越方便。 2. 跟风潮流:盲目跟随热门框架,不考虑自身需求。
二、框架选择的关键因素
1. 技术栈兼容性:确保框架与现有技术栈兼容,避免后期集成困难。 2. 性能优化:关注框架的执行效率和内存占用,确保小程序流畅运行。 3. 生态支持:考虑框架的社区活跃度、插件丰富程度,便于后期扩展和优化。 4. 开发效率:评估框架提供的组件、工具和模板,提高开发效率。
三、常见框架对比
1. WeChat Mini Program Framework:官方框架,性能稳定,生态丰富,但开发效率相对较低。 2. Taro:跨平台框架,支持React、Vue、小程序等,开发效率高,但性能稍逊于官方框架。 3. uni-app:全端统一开发框架,支持H5、小程序、App等,开发效率高,但性能和生态相对较弱。
四、避坑技巧
1. 充分调研:了解各框架的优势和劣势,结合自身需求进行选择。 2. 试用体验:通过实际项目验证框架的性能和稳定性。 3. 社区支持:关注框架的社区活跃度,及时获取解决方案和技术支持。
五、总结
选择合适的小程序开发框架,有助于提高开发效率、降低成本,并保证小程序的性能和稳定性。开发者应结合自身需求,理性选择框架,避免陷入常见陷阱。
本文由 华泰软件有限公司 整理发布。